Frequently Asked Questions

What is Kishu Inu (KISHU)?
Kishu Inu is a decentralized community-built cryptocurrency that was inspired by the meme coin trend. It positions itself as a fun, community-driven project with a focus on creating a decentralized ecosystem for its holders.

What factors influence the price of KISHU?
The price is primarily influenced by overall cryptocurrency market sentiment, Bitcoin's price action, social media trends and hype, exchange listings, trading volume, and developments or announcements from the project's core team.

Is investing in Kishu Inu considered high risk?
Yes, like all meme coins and small-market-cap cryptocurrencies, KISHU is considered a high-risk, high-volatility investment. Its price can experience extreme fluctuations based on speculation rather than fundamental utility.

How can I conduct technical analysis on KISHU?
You can analyze KISHU by using charting platforms that offer tools like RSI, MACD, and Bollinger Bands. Studying trading volume, order book depth, and key support/resistance levels can also provide insights.
